Step-by-step explanation:
Max accidently mixed 56 turnip seeds and 78 cabbage seeds together because the two seeds look nearly
identical. The probability of choosing a turnips seed will be:
Turnip seed= 56
Cabbage seeds= 78
Total seeds= 56+78 = 134
Probability of choosing a turnips seed:
= 56/134
= 0.42

Answer:
Therefore the car takes 2 s to reach a minimum height from the ground before rising again.
Step-by-step explanation:
Given that a roller coaster ride reach a height of 80 feet.
The height above the ground of the roller coaster is modeled by the function
h(t)=10t²-40t+80
where t is measured in second.
h(t)=10t²-40t+80
Differentiating with respect to t
h'(t)= 10(2t)-40
⇒h'(t)=20t-40
To find the minimum height we set h'(t)=0
∴20t-40=0
⇒20t =40
⇒t=2
The height of the roller coaster minimum when t=2 s.
The minimum height of of the roller coaster is
h(2)= 10(2)²-40.2+80
=40-80+80
=40 feet.
Therefore the car takes 2 s to reach a minimum height from the ground before rising again.
Answer:
f(n) = - 0.5n + 6
Step-by-step explanation:
Because Vince cuts down his television watching at a steady pace, his situation models a linear function. As such, we can use slope-intercept form to write and predict his hours watching tv in n weeks.
Slope-intercept form is y=mx+b. In this case, we are choosing to use f(n) instead of y to show the number of hours he is watching tv. We are also choosing to use n weeks instead of x. So we have the form f(n)=mn+b.
We know that Vince starts out at watching 6 hours a week. This is our initial value known as the y-intercept and represented by b. As each week passes, he will decrease from the previous week by 30 minutes or -0.5 hours since 30 out of 60 minutes is 0.5. And since he is decreasing it should be a negative rate of -0.5 and is represented by m.
We substitute b=6 and m=0.5 into our form to get f(n)=-0.5n+6. Let's test week 1. After 1 week he should be down from 6 hours to 5.5 hours or 5 hours and 30 minutes. Let's substitute n=1.
f(n)=-0.5(1)+6=-0.5+6=5.5
We can substitute for any n week and find the amount.
